Finding the Perfect Smocked Lampshade
Choosing the right one depends on your specific needs and aesthetic. Consider the size, shape, and color to ensure it complements your lamp and overall décor. Here are a few things to think about:
- Size Matters: A small lampshade might be perfect for a sconce or mini table lamp, while a large one will make a statement on a floor lamp.
- Shape Up: Empire, drum, and bell shapes offer different aesthetics. The empire shade is a classic choice, while the drum shade provides a more modern, streamlined look. A bell shade adds a touch of traditional elegance.
- Color Coordination: White, ivory, and black shades are versatile and can complement any color scheme. For a pop of color, consider pink, blue, or even red.

Q: How does the smocking affect the light that is emitted from the lampshade?
A: The smocking on a lampshade beautifully diffuses the light, creating a warm and inviting glow. The pleats and folds soften the light, reducing glare and casting interesting shadows that add depth and dimension to your room.
